Knowledge Manager salary in Belgium

Average Yearly Salary of Knowledge Manager in Belgium is approximately 75,123 EUR (75,067 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Knowledge Manager do?

occupation personasA Knowledge Manager is responsible for organizing, capturing, and disseminating knowledge within an organization. They develop strategies to ensure that valuable information and expertise are shared effectively among employees, enabling them to make informed decisions and improve overall productivity. The role involves identifying knowledge gaps, creating knowledge-sharing platforms, and implementing processes to capture and document best practices. Knowledge Managers also collaborate with various departments to develop training programs and facilitate knowledge transfer. Additionally, they may conduct research and analysis to stay updated on industry trends and emerging technologies.
